# Artifact Signing — Fuseguard

Hey, welcome aboard! Fuseguard is our circuit breaker sitting in front of the Corvane upstream API, and every build of it ships as a signed artifact. The CI box at Halloway handles packaging, but signing happens in the release step you'll be running. Don't skip verification even for patch builds — unsigned Fuseguard binaries get rejected by the deploy gate. When you're ready to sign, use the key below.

signing key of baduf-taweg = bky6_Zf7bem

Subject: Franchise agreement — status

Team,

The Calverro franchise agreement is signed. Key terms: seven-year term, territory limited to the Midhaven corridor, royalty stepped after year three. Finance actions: set up the remittance schedule, confirm the marketing fund accrual, and flag the minimum-purchase clause in the forecast. Legal cleared the termination provisions last week. Orsa owns the onboarding plan; first store conversion targeted for autumn. Nothing else blocking. The confidential commercial note sits directly below.

management briefing: Eliaxax Works is in early talks to buy Casoxox Systems for about $61.5 million. The Framir launch date is May 17, and nothing goes to the press before then.

Handing LotPulse over before my leave — quick brain dump. The occupancy feed polls the garage sensors every 30s; the Delver Street garage lies about level 3, so we clamp it (see occupancy_fixups.py, yes it's ugly, sorry). Watch the reconnect backoff in the poller, it's the usual suspect when counts freeze. Design notes, sensor quirks, and the test harness are documented on the internal page below.

wiki page, bawef-hafop: https://jira.nelvroworks.corp/job/pages/projects/7c5c0f440dbd

## Releases

Queuepress compaction builds are released monthly and only after the compaction fuzz suite passes on all three retention profiles. Each tarball is accompanied by a detached signature, and reviewers should confirm that compacted-segment checksums match the manifest before approving rollout. All artifacts for the 3.x line are verified against the following signing key.

signing key of bagap-yawep = bky13_TbfT6ZMUoGJo2